Alameda County Fair Festivities Continue Through the Weekend

by CC News
Pleasanton

Second Weekend Highlights Include Brew Fest, Horse Racing, Fiesta at the Fair Festival and Concerts from Quiet Riot, Queen Nation and Mi Banda

Pleasanton, Calif.  – The family fun and festivities continue through the second weekend of the Alameda County Fair.

On Friday, June 23, the Fair will feature horse racing, Keith Sayers FMX Motocross performances, the Imperial Knights Extreme Medieval Stunt Show, a concert from Quiet Riot and a nightly drone show, presented by Spare the Air.

Saturday, June 24, will feature the popular Brew Fest from 2-5pm at the Stella Artois Grandstand. The tasting event requires separate admission from the regular Fair but features unlimited tastings from 19 different breweries.

Guests who aren’t able to attend the Brew Fest can still enjoy a frosty beverage any day at the Fair’s brand new Jack Daniel’s Double Decker Saloon.

Sunday, June 25, will showcase the popular “Fiesta at the Fair”, presented by Casamigos, cultural festival celebrating Latin heritage. The festival includes performances from Mariachi San Francisco, Danza Azteca, and Ballet Folklorico Mexicano de Carlos Moreno.

Children 5 and under are always free, and military personnel can also receive one free admission any day of the Fair with valid Military ID.

All the Fair favorites, including delicious Fair food, shopping, pig races, carnival rides and games, and grand selfie spots are available all day every day.

The Alameda County Agricultural Fair Association, a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ization, produces the annual Alameda County Fair without any tax funding from the government. It is ranked one of the top 50 North American Fairs and the 7th largest fair in California. The Fairgrounds is home to the oldest one-mile race track in America
